University of North Florida Acceptance rate and admissions statistics
University of North Florida has an acceptance rate of 53% and is among the top 17% of the most difficult universities to gain admission to in the United States. The university reports the admission statistics without distinguishing between local and international students.
| Total | Men | Women |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Acceptance Rate | 53% | 50% | 55% |
| Applicants | 21,778 | 8,207 | 13,571 |
| Admissions | 11,594 | 4,098 | 7,496 |
| Freshmen enrolled full time | 1,801 | 711 | 1,090 |
| Freshmen enrolled part time | 107 | 36 | 71 |
8,937 students enrolled in some distance education courses.
2,723 enrolled exclusively in distance education.

University of North Florida has a graduation rate of 69%, which is among the 24% highest for universities in the US.
| Total | Men | Women |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Graduation rate | 69% | 68% | 70% |

University of North Florida has published 9,900 scientific papers with 171,482 citations received. The research profile covers a range of fields, including Liberal Arts & Social Sciences, Computer Science, Medicine, Biology, Political Science, Law, Environmental Science, Engineering, Psychology, and Sociology.
